Description
The Kings Head Inn is an 18th-century inn located on the east side of The Broadway in Thatcham. The building is rendered to give the appearance of ashlar and features a coped parapet along with an old tiled roof that has an end stack on the left. It has two storeys and four bays, with glazing bar sash windows. The entrance is a half-glazed door situated in the second bay from the left. To the left, there is a one-storey addition that is also rendered and tiled, which includes a boarded door and one glazing bar sash window.
